Shift Linkage, C6

Fig. 3 Floor Shift Control Linkage:





Fig. 4 Shift Control Linkage:






1. With ignition switch in Off position and parking brake applied, place transmission selector lever into Drive (D) position and hold against the (D) stop by installing an 8 lb. weight onto the selector lever knob.
2. Loosen shift rod adjusting nut at point A, Figs. 3 and 4.
3. Place transmission manual lever into Drive position by moving lever completely rearward, then forward 2 detents.
4. With selector lever and transmission manual lever in Drive (D) position, torque nut at point A to 12-18 ft. lbs.
5. Remove weight from the steering column selector lever knob.
6. Operate shift lever in all gear positions to ensure that manual lever is in full detent. Adjust lever, if necessary.
7. On F150, F250, F350 and Bronco models, ensure correct operation of the automatic selector indicator (PRND21). Do not adjust linkage in any position other than the Drive (D) position.
